5 Tips to Negotiate the Best Settlement for My Totaled Car
In 2021 there was a 12 percent rise in road accident fatalities in America. Worse still, the trend is rising. The per-mile accident rate is at its highest point. Each time you hit the road, the chances of being involved in a damaging car!-->…